CANDLER – William Hoyt Woodard, 81, died Monday, Aug. 31, 2020 at CarePartners Solace Center.
A native of Macon County, he was a son of the late William and Nina Brooks Woodard. He was also preceded in death by a sister, Shirley Guyer, as well as three brothers, Cleve, Joe and Jack Woodard.
A U.S. Army veteran, Hoyt was the owner and operator of Asheville Powertrain for 36 years as well as owner and operator of Hayes & Hopson Auto Supply for 14 years. He served on several boards and committees to include the Automotive Aftermarket Association of the Mid-South and Power Heavy Duty of America.
Hoyt is survived by his loving wife of 59 years, Garnetta Vanhook Woodard; two sons, William Hoyt Woodard Jr. (Stephanie) of Asheville and Barry Earl Woodard (Susan) of Cary; three grandchildren, Savannah, Meredith and Will Woodard; as well as several nieces and nephews.
